The Basics of Sound Design in Casinos
Sound design in casinos encompasses various auditory stimuli, including background music, sound effects from games, and noise levels. These elements are carefully crafted to create a unique atmosphere that can elicit specific psychological responses. For instance, upbeat music may promote a sense of excitement, while soothing tones could provide a feeling of comfort and relaxation. The incorporation of familiar sounds, like the spin of a slot machine or the clinking of chips, amplifies the authenticity of the experience, making players feel more engaged and connected to the environment.
Psychological Effects of Sound on Players
Psychology plays a significant role in how players perceive sound in casinos. Research suggests that certain sounds can enhance pleasure, increase playtime, and even influence decision-making processes. Here are some of the key psychological effects of sound design in casinos:

- Emotional Response: Sounds can evoke emotions. Fast-paced music can instill feelings of exhilaration, while slower tunes might induce relaxation. This emotional modulation is critical as it can encourage longer sessions of play.
- Enhancing Engagement: Unique sound effects linked to specific games can create an enhanced sense of involvement. For example, the sounds that play when a player wins can lead to euphoria, reinforcing the desire to play more.
- Auditory Cues and Decision Making: Sound can provide cues that influence decision-making. Rewarding sounds after making a bet can trigger a conditioned response, leading players to make bolder choices.
- Masking Unpleasant Noises: The ambient sounds in casinos often serve to mask less desirable noises, such as the sound of large crowds or construction. A carefully curated sound design helps maintain an inviting atmosphere.
The Role of Ambient Music in Casinos
Ambient music is meticulously selected and played at specific volumes to create a particular atmosphere. Research indicates that background music can affect how long players choose to stay in a casino and how much they are willing to spend. Casinos often opt for music that has a tempo aligning with their desired level of excitement. For example, slower tempos may encourage more relaxed gameplay while faster tempos can increase the adrenaline and thrill associated with high-stakes gambling.
Sound in Slot Machines
Slot machines are a quintessential part of casino dynamics, heavily relying on unique sound design to enhance player experience. Each game features its own set of sound effects that reinforce branding while creating an immersive environment. The sounds of coins falling, bells ringing, and celebratory music when winning are specifically designed to trigger positive responses. These auditory cues contribute to what psychologists refer to as the “near-miss” phenomenon, where players feel a thrill when they come close to winning, even if they don’t. Such design keeps players focused and encourages ongoing play.

The Ethical Considerations of Sound Design
While sound design in casinos offers significant psychological advantages for player experience, ethical considerations arise. Strategies that manipulate emotional responses can lead to excessive gambling. As such, the balance between creating an engaging environment and ensuring responsible gambling practices is paramount. Casinos are increasingly becoming aware of their responsibilities regarding player well-being, leading to discussions surrounding regulatory frameworks and sound design practices.
